Openbravo Issue Tracking System - Retail Modules |
View Issue Details |
|
ID | Project | Category | View Status | Date Submitted | Last Update |
0033178 | Retail Modules | Web POS | public | 2016-06-07 18:09 | 2018-03-19 09:43 |
|
Reporter | shuehner | |
Assigned To | Sandrahuguet | |
Priority | normal | Severity | minor | Reproducibility | have not tried |
Status | closed | Resolution | fixed | |
Platform | | OS | 5 | OS Version | |
Product Version | | |
Target Version | | Fixed in Version | RR18Q2 | |
Merge Request Status | |
Review Assigned To | marvintm |
OBNetwork customer | No |
Support ticket | |
Regression level | |
Regression date | |
Regression introduced in release | |
Regression introduced by commit | |
Triggers an Emergency Pack | No |
|
Summary | 0033178: Service project related code in OrderLoader re-reads just created orderline |
Description | The createLinesForServiceProduct method gets a hash-map of orderline_id's as input and then uses DAL to read those orderlines.
However those lines have been just created 1 method before in the OrderLoader process so rereading those from database is most likely not required (could be i.e. passed down into this function).
|
Steps To Reproduce | if services is used: we get extra OrderLine reads via:
createLinesForServicesProduct:
OrderLine rol = OBDal.getInstance().get(OrderLine.class,
relatedJsonOrderLine.get("orderlineId")); |
Proposed Solution | |
Additional Information | |
Tags | Performance |
Relationships | related to | defect | 0033137 | | closed | shuehner | Useless m_product read from services product even if services are not used | depends on | defect | 0038156 | | closed | Sandrahuguet | API Change: Added new parameter to createLinesForServiceProduct |
|
Attached Files | |
|
Issue History |
Date Modified | Username | Field | Change |
2016-06-07 18:09 | shuehner | New Issue | |
2016-06-07 18:09 | shuehner | Assigned To | => Retail |
2016-06-07 18:09 | shuehner | OBNetwork customer | => No |
2016-06-07 18:09 | shuehner | Triggers an Emergency Pack | => No |
2016-06-07 18:09 | shuehner | Relationship added | related to 0033137 |
2016-06-07 18:10 | shuehner | Tag Attached: Performance | |
2018-03-14 13:14 | Sandrahuguet | Assigned To | Retail => Sandrahuguet |
2018-03-14 15:30 | Sandrahuguet | Review Assigned To | => marvintm |
2018-03-15 08:23 | hgbot | Checkin | |
2018-03-15 08:23 | hgbot | Note Added: 0103262 | |
2018-03-15 08:23 | hgbot | Status | new => resolved |
2018-03-15 08:23 | hgbot | Resolution | open => fixed |
2018-03-15 08:23 | hgbot | Fixed in SCM revision | => http://code.openbravo.com/erp/pmods/org.openbravo.retail.posterminal/rev/8b8a6e7d57f1a8c180b2d70cc4e4e5e1fc7d6db9 [^] |
2018-03-15 09:27 | Sandrahuguet | Note Added: 0103269 | |
2018-03-15 09:28 | Sandrahuguet | Note Edited: 0103269 | bug_revision_view_page.php?bugnote_id=0103269#r16852 |
2018-03-15 09:28 | Sandrahuguet | Note Edited: 0103269 | bug_revision_view_page.php?bugnote_id=0103269#r16853 |
2018-03-16 10:01 | Sandrahuguet | Relationship added | depends on 0038156 |
2018-03-16 10:01 | Sandrahuguet | Status | resolved => new |
2018-03-16 10:01 | Sandrahuguet | Resolution | fixed => open |
2018-03-16 10:02 | Sandrahuguet | Status | new => scheduled |
2018-03-16 14:05 | hgbot | Checkin | |
2018-03-16 14:05 | hgbot | Note Added: 0103317 | |
2018-03-16 14:05 | hgbot | Status | scheduled => resolved |
2018-03-16 14:05 | hgbot | Resolution | open => fixed |
2018-03-16 14:05 | hgbot | Fixed in SCM revision | http://code.openbravo.com/erp/pmods/org.openbravo.retail.posterminal/rev/8b8a6e7d57f1a8c180b2d70cc4e4e5e1fc7d6db9 [^] => http://code.openbravo.com/erp/pmods/org.openbravo.retail.posterminal/rev/461eb39d1f40feeac0d2174acdf45571f03cb475 [^] |
2018-03-19 09:43 | marvintm | Status | resolved => closed |
2018-03-19 09:43 | marvintm | Fixed in Version | => RR18Q2 |